The East Goshen Township ecosystem supports 54 documented wildlife species across 53 taxonomic genera. Located in chester county, pennsylvania, this area provides critical habitat with diverse natural communities. The location hosts 11 frequently observed species and 10 occasionally documented species, creating a balanced ecosystem with both resident and visiting wildlife. While Chester County nearby has 46% more documented species, East Goshen Township offers unique wildlife observation opportunities. This location ranks #14 for species diversity among 67 chester county County natural areas, placing it in the 79th percentile for biodiversity.
